FORTRAN Full Form
FORTRAN stands for “Formula Translation”. It is one of the earliest high-level programming languages developed to facilitate scientific and engineering computations. Created by a team led by John Backus at IBM in the 1950s, FORTRAN played a pivotal role in making computers accessible for complex mathematical calculations, paving the way for advancements in various scientific disciplines. Historical Significance of FORTRAN
The historical significance of FORTRAN lies in its role as the first widely-used high-level programming language. Prior to FORTRAN, programmers had to write machine-level code, a tedious and error-prone process that required a deep understanding of the computer’s architecture. FORTRAN, with its focus on mathematical formulas, provided a higher level of abstraction, allowing scientists and engineers to express complex calculations more intuitively.
FORTRAN was first introduced in 1957 with the release of FORTRAN I. Subsequent versions, such as FORTRAN II, FORTRAN IV, and FORTRAN 77, brought improvements and additional features, solidifying its status as a cornerstone in the history of programming languages.
Key Features of FORTRAN
- Formula-Oriented Syntax: FORTRAN’s syntax is designed to resemble mathematical formulas, making it easy for scientists and engineers to translate mathematical algorithms directly into code.
- Array Processing: FORTRAN introduced native support for array processing, a crucial feature for scientific and engineering applications that often involve manipulating large sets of data.
- Efficient Code Generation: The early versions of FORTRAN were optimized for efficient code generation, allowing programs to run more quickly and effectively on the limited computational resources of early computers.
- Portability: Despite variations in hardware architectures, FORTRAN programs were relatively portable, enabling them to run on different machines with minimal modifications.
- Subroutines and Functions: FORTRAN introduced the concept of subroutines and functions, allowing developers to modularize their code and promote reusability.
Impact on Scientific Computing
FORTRAN’s impact on scientific computing was profound. Its ability to express complex mathematical operations in a concise and readable manner made it the language of choice for scientists and engineers working on numerical simulations, data analysis, and mathematical modeling. The development of FORTRAN coincided with the growth of scientific research that heavily relied on computational methods, leading to a symbiotic relationship between the language and advancements in various scientific disciplines.
The efficiency and reliability of FORTRAN contributed significantly to the success of early computer-based scientific research, including weather modeling, structural analysis, and nuclear simulations. As computers evolved, so did FORTRAN, with newer versions incorporating features like structured programming constructs and enhanced support for data manipulation.
Evolution of FORTRAN
Over the years, FORTRAN has evolved to keep pace with changing computing paradigms. FORTRAN 77, introduced in 1977, brought additional features such as character data types and structured programming constructs. Subsequent versions, including Fortran 90, Fortran 95, and Fortran 2003, introduced modern programming constructs, enhanced support for parallel computing, and improved language features.
While newer programming languages have emerged, and the programming landscape has diversified, FORTRAN continues to be relevant in specific domains, particularly in scientific and high-performance computing. Its legacy is evident in the continued use of Fortran-based codes in fields such as computational physics, weather modeling, and aerospace engineering.
